Output 359101721b86e7ff8c24df84f0399bbb5da4dc7ad3f9bed740be3f8b9864aa66:84

value
26049900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83c6354801e3aed4ce82df676551965c94c59fa OP_EQUAL
address
3QKZqx4FpJSTMnGSydGyUE4hdfDVWi882G
transaction
359101721b86e7ff8c24df84f0399bbb5da4dc7ad3f9bed740be3f8b9864aa66
spent
true